+#include <assert.h>
+#include <errno.h>
+#include <time.h>
+#include <hp-timing.h>
+#include <sysdep-cancel.h>
+
+#if HP_TIMING_AVAIL
+# define CPUCLOCK_P(clock) \
+ ((clock) == CLOCK_PROCESS_CPUTIME_ID \
+ || ((clock) & ((1 << CLOCK_IDFIELD_SIZE) - 1)) == CLOCK_THREAD_CPUTIME_ID)
+#else
+# define CPUCLOCK_P(clock) 0
+#endif
+
+#ifndef INVALID_CLOCK_P
+# define INVALID_CLOCK_P(cl) \
+ ((cl) < CLOCK_REALTIME || (cl) > CLOCK_THREAD_CPUTIME_ID)
+#endif
+
+
+/* This implementation assumes that these is only a `nanosleep' system
+ call. So we have to remap all other activities. */
+int
+__clock_nanosleep (clockid_t clock_id, int flags, const struct timespec *req,
+ struct timespec *rem)
+{
+ struct timespec now;
+
+ if (__builtin_expect (req->tv_nsec, 0) < 0
+ || __builtin_expect (req->tv_nsec, 0) >= 1000000000)
+ return EINVAL;
+
+ if (clock_id == CLOCK_THREAD_CPUTIME_ID)
+ return EINVAL; /* POSIX specifies EINVAL for this case. */
+
+#ifdef SYSDEP_NANOSLEEP
+ SYSDEP_NANOSLEEP;
+#endif
+
+ if (CPUCLOCK_P (clock_id))
+ return ENOTSUP;
+
+ if (INVALID_CLOCK_P (clock_id))
+ return EINVAL;
+
+ /* If we got an absolute time, remap it. */
+ if (flags == TIMER_ABSTIME)
+ {
+ long int nsec;
+ long int sec;
+
+ /* Make sure we use safe data types. */
+ assert (sizeof (sec) >= sizeof (now.tv_sec));
+
+ /* Get the current time for this clock. */
+ if (__builtin_expect (clock_gettime (clock_id, &now), 0) != 0)
+ return errno;
+
+ /* Compute the difference. */
+ nsec = req->tv_nsec - now.tv_nsec;
+ sec = req->tv_sec - now.tv_sec - (nsec < 0);
+ if (sec < 0)
+ /* The time has already elapsed. */
+ return 0;
+
+ now.tv_sec = sec;
+ now.tv_nsec = nsec + (nsec < 0 ? 1000000000 : 0);
+
+ /* From now on this is our time. */
+ req = &now;
+
+ /* Make sure we are not modifying the struct pointed to by REM. */
+ rem = NULL;
+ }
+ else if (__builtin_expect (flags, 0) != 0)
+ return EINVAL;
+ else if (clock_id != CLOCK_REALTIME)
+ /* Not supported. */
+ return ENOTSUP;
+
+ return __builtin_expect (nanosleep (req, rem), 0) ? errno : 0;
+}
+weak_alias (__clock_nanosleep, clock_nanosleep)
